Mechanic Advisor

Truck Mechanics in DeLand, FL

more than 18 million people have chosen Mechanic Advisor
  • exclusive coupons & offers
  • detailed business information
  • user testimonials & reviews
Grade A Automotive
Grade A Automotive 520 Ridgewood Avenue Holly Hill, FL 32117
Central Florida Fleet Service, Inc
Central Florida Fleet Service, Inc 2001 Thompson Nursery Road Lake Wales, FL 33859
YourMechanic
YourMechanic We come to you! Altamonte Springs, FL 32714
Top Rated DeLand Truck Mechanics
Truck Mechanics by Vehicle Type
View All Vehicle Types in DeLand